Middelgrundsfortet, formerly known as Fort Middelgrund and now officially referred to as Ungdomsøen or The Youth Island since 2015, is a highly advanced sea fort situated on an artificial island in the Øresund strait between Copenhagen's harbor and Malmö's coastline. This formidable fortress was strategically constructed at a spot where the seabed plunges to a depth of approximately seven meters below the water's surface, serving as the confluence point for the Kongedybet and Hollænderdybet channels. As the largest sea fortress in the world, Middelgrundsfortet still maintains its title as the biggest man-made island without any supporting structures, boasting an expansive area covering roughly 70,000 square meters when including wave breakers. The total built-up area of the fortress amounts to approximately 15,000 square meters. Images used for this article were sourced from publicly accessible archives at kortforsyningen.dk
